The Manitoba Zero Tillage
Research Association (MZTRA) Research Farm is located
12 miles North of Brandon, MB at the corner of #10
highway and the Brookdale Road (#353). Founded in
1993, the MZTRA is a non-profit, producer directed
association which addresses zero tillage production
problems through field scale research.
|
| The farm is a center for learning and
exchanging information on reduced tillage practices.
Research on the farm focuses on cropping systems, following
the implementation of a long term annual cropping rotation
and livestock based rotation. Research is conducted
by Agriculture and Agri-food Canada, the University
of Manitoba, and Manitoba Agriculture Food and Rural
Initiatives. The association itself also conducts many
in house research projects on the farm. |
